WebWith Adobe Acrobat Pro you can open Adobe Acrobat Pro PDFs and import your PDF file. Go to Tools, either left or right of the screen, and click Print Production. From here we continue to the Preflight tab. A pop-up window opens from where you can select the items present in your file (e.g., comments and form fields). Click Scan and Repair. WebSep 27, 2024 · Tools > Print Production > Preflight > PDF fixups > Flatten annotations and form fields and then click on Analyze and fix. WebMany PDF files contain comments and markups (collectively called "annotations") and form fields, placed by reviewers or filled-in and returned by a forms recipient. Often when archiving the PDF file you need to preserve some of these in a non-editable format; a process which Acrobat calls "flattening". dr shonda wood springville al

WebJan 5, 2016 · Steps: 1. Go to Print Production app. 2. Click on Preflight option from Right panel. 3. Search for the fixup "Flatten annotations and form fields". 4. Run the … WebDec 1, 2010 · The Flatten Fields and Comments Action will not be available unless a document is open. Open the Tools Pane and choose the Action Wizard and click the Flatten Fields and Comments Action — or— Choose File> Action Wizard> Flatten Fields and Comments 2. Acrobat will ask you to confirm that you wish to run the Action. Click the …
